首页 > 用Unity和C#创建在线多人游戏学习教程

用Unity和C#创建在线多人游戏学习教程

用Unity和C#创建在线多人游戏学习教程 Unity-第1张



MP4 |视频:h264,1280×720 |音频:AAC,44.1 KHz,2 Ch

语言:英语+中英文字幕(根据原英文字幕机译更准确) |时长:58节课(6h 41m) |大小解压后:6.1 GB

用Unity和C#创建在线多人游戏以及如何创建基于Turn的多人游戏

你会学到:

了解如何使用Unity和C#创建在线多人游戏。

使用C#为多人游戏创建简单到复杂的脚本

了解游戏开发过程。

实现编写可维护代码的最佳编码实践

发展强大的和可转移的解决问题的技能。

学习制作在线多人游戏的客户端-服务器模式。

学习同步各种设备上的游戏



要求

在开始本课程之前,您应该了解Unity的基础知识。像保存场景、导航界面、创建预设以及在检查器中添加和修改组件。

您应该了解C#的基础知识,例如创建变量、修改变量和调用函数。

能够运行Unity的Mac或PC

Unity 2019或更新版本的副本

问答和社区的常规互联网接入。

用Unity和C#创建在线多人游戏学习教程 Unity-第2张

描述

了解如何使用Unity创建自己的制作就绪的在线多人回合制卡牌游戏。我们将从基本的多人游戏概念开始,一起创建一个基于生产就绪回合的在线扑克游戏,该游戏可以发布到谷歌游戏商店和苹果应用商店等应用商店。

本课程旨在让每个人都能轻松理解,唯一需要具备的是Unity和C#的基本知识,因为我们将深入中间编程概念,当然还有学习创建自己的在线多人游戏的热情。

在本课程中,我们将创建一个基于在线回合的多人扑克游戏,但您学习的网络原则和策略将适用于您希望的任何类型的在线游戏。在课程结束时,我们将创建一个生产就绪的游戏,已经实现了设计原则,以保持我们的代码的大代码库和可读性。

在本课程结束时,您会对以下内容感到满意:

管理各种类型的网络游戏。

指导复杂游戏的基本多人游戏原则。

追踪网络玩家和NPC。

创建游戏内聊天系统。

创建排行榜系统。

创建交互式用户界面。

将设计原则应用到大型代码库中。

以及更多的概念…

从今天开始学习,让我来帮助你的游戏开发之旅。

这门课是给谁上的:

对学习如何制作多人游戏感兴趣的学生。

想创作和发布自己游戏的人。

本课程面向想要创建自己的多人游戏的中级Unity用户。

经验丰富的游戏开发人员。

这门课是给谁的

对学习如何制作多人游戏感兴趣的学生。

想创作和发布自己游戏的人。

本课程也是为那些想要深入研究中级编码,并使用C#编程多人游戏体验的人准备的

用Unity和C#创建在线多人游戏学习教程 Unity-第3张



用Unity和C#创建在线多人游戏学习教程 Unity-第4张

更多相关:

  • 腐蚀Rust这个游戏的细节取决于图像质量也就是我们进入游戏的时候可以选择画质,这里为大家带来腐蚀Rust画质设置教程。图像质量 1~3为一个大档 4~5是一个大档 4以上你在游戏里面的画面会显示更多细节的东西 大家可以从下面图片的半自动机瞄下面的图案来看清3档一下和4档以上的差距第一个画线选项PARTICLE QUALITY:这是粒子...

  • 多人乱斗闯关游戏《糖豆人:终极淘汰赛(Fall Guys: Ultimate Knockout)》于8月4日正式发售,目前已登陆Steam、PS4平台,PS会员可免费领取。在游戏发售后受到主播直播的带动,大量的玩家疯狂涌入,这款娱乐性极强的游戏迅速登顶Steam全球销量榜。虽然游戏的服务器不堪重负,多次出现问题,玩家们不停的为游戏打出...

  • Razer 雷蛇 那伽梵蛇 Pro 专业版 无线蓝牙鼠标【PConline 聚超值】那伽梵蛇 Pro 专业版升级为蓝牙双模无线游戏鼠标,针对MMO/MOBA/RTS等游戏玩家,保留了侧裙整个按键面板可以更换(有2/6/12按键)的设定。采用磁吸式方式固定,可根据手感和游戏需求选择自己所需要的面板,最多20个可编程按键。Razer Hy...

  • 游戏开发变得简单。使用Unity学习C#并创建您自己的动作角色扮演游戏! 你会学到什么 学习C#,一种现代通用的编程语言。 了解Unity中2D发展的能力。 发展强大的和可移植的解决问题的技能。 了解游戏开发流程。 了解面向对象编程在实践中是如何工作的。 Learn To Create An Action RPG Game I...

  • 从头开始学习设计和开发3款游戏(无需经验) 你会学到什么 如何塑造令人敬畏的角色 如何使用GameMakerStudio 2 视频游戏编程 基本二维动画 如何查找和修复bug 如何给你的游戏编故事 从哪里获得游戏资产(免费) 如何添加声音效果 如何发展你的游戏理念 游戏设计力学 如何制作有趣的关卡 如何设置游戏难度 如何添加视觉效...

  • 为了方便创建Component,请自行安装插件       接下来就是创建组件需要绑定入参in和事件out(用于输出参数)  运行效果如下(可以点击红色文字,就获取到了子组件传出的内容)...

  • 第1步 在stmg/src/main/webapp/subsystem下创建一个newPage文件夹 在newPage文件夹下新建一个newSubPage.jsp文件 <%@ page language="java" import="java.util.*" pageEncoding="UTF-8" %> <%String pat...

  • 学习在Substance Designer中创建复杂材料的高级技术。 如果你想进入游戏行业,想学习如何创建高质量的纹理和学习物质设计,那么这个课程是给你的。 我设计了这个课程,从一开始就带你,教你我用来创建AAA纹理的3个步骤:图案,雕刻和细节。 看完这个课程后,你会觉得非常有信心创造一个AAA级纹理,你可以把它放在你的作品集里...

  • 了解如何使用C#在Unity中创建您的第一款2D平台游戏 你会学到什么 使用Unity创建2D奥运会 使用可脚本化的对象和单一模式 使用良好的编程实践 创造武器和射弹 使用可脚本化的对象和委托模式创建强大且通用的人工智能 创造具有多重能力的角色 创建级别组件 MP4 |视频:h264,1280×720 |音频:AAC,44.1...

  • 在Unity中学习高级粒子系统和视觉效果创建。初级到中级 你会学到: 游戏的视觉效果 Unity粒子系统 Unity中的Vfx 创建Unity视觉效果的初级到中级指南 课程获取:Unity粒子系统创建VFX游戏特效学习教程-云桥网 MP4 |视频:h264,1280×720 |音频:AAC,44.1 KHz,2 Ch 语言...